Hillgrove Resources (HGO) 2025 Earnings Call Presentation
2025-08-04 08:50
Corporate Overview - Hillgrove Resources has a share price of $0.036 and a market capitalization of $94 million [9] - The company possesses $11 million in cash and $282 million in income tax losses [9] - Freepoint Metals & Concentrates is a major shareholder with 18.9% ownership, followed by Ariadne Australia with 10.3% [9] Production and Cost Metrics (June 2025 Half) - Total tonnes processed reached 669kt with a grade of 0.88% [25] - Copper production amounted to 5,545 tonnes, and payable copper sold was 5,481 tonnes at an average realized price of A$14,232 per tonne [25] - C1 Costs were A$4.68/lb, and All-in Cost excluding Nugent was US$4.10/lb [25] Resource and Reserve - The 2024 Kanmantoo Mineral Resource Estimate is 19.3Mt grading 0.77% Cu and 0.14g/t Au, containing 150kt Cu and 82koz Au [30] - The 2024 Maiden Ore Reserve is 2.8Mt grading 0.91% Cu and 0.15g/t Au, containing 26kt Cu and 14koz Au [30] - Compared to the 2022 Mineral Resource Estimate, there was a 96% increase in contained copper and a 138% increase in contained gold [31] Future Plans - The company plans approximately 20 Km of drilling in 2025 targeting resource expansion, with an early focus on Valentines, Kavanagh, and Nugent [32] - Nugent development aims to reduce mining and processing unit costs by approximately 15-20% [23]
Freeport-McMoRan(FCX) - 2025 Q2 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-07-23 15:00
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Freeport-McMoRan reported quarterly EBITDA of $3.2 billion and operating cash flows of $2.2 billion, with net unit cash production costs at $1.13 per pound, significantly improved from previous guidance and last year's second quarter [10][11][12] - The average copper realization price was over $4.5 per pound, approximately $0.20 per pound above international benchmark pricing [11] - The company expects copper sales in the second half of the year to be nearly 10% higher than the first half volumes [11][46]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Sales of copper and gold exceeded forecasts, with a net credit for operating costs at Grasberg of $0.99 per pound [10][37] - The startup of the new copper smelter in Indonesia was a significant milestone, with production of first cathodes expected by the end of the month [12][29] - The leach initiative is projected to achieve a run rate of £300 million by the end of the year, targeting £800 million per annum [15][34]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- Copper prices averaged $4.32 on the London Metals Exchange and $4.72 on the U.S. COMEX exchange during the quarter [18] - The U.S. copper premium has tripled from second quarter levels, providing an approximate $1.7 billion annual financial benefit on U.S. sales [24][25] - Global copper demand continues to benefit from trends in electrification, AI technology, and decarbonization, with China and India being major growth markets [20][21] Company Strategy and Development Direction - Freeport-McMoRan is committed to its long-term strategy focused on copper production, with significant organic growth opportunities in the U.S. and a strong position in Indonesia and South America [6][9] - The company is advancing three major project opportunities in the Americas and is focused on innovation and technology to enhance productivity and cost performance [17][43] - The company aims to boost domestic copper supplies and is actively working on legislative recognition of copper as a critical mineral [27][35]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in continued strong financial performance, driven by high copper demand and successful operational initiatives [11][12] - The impact of tariffs on costs is being closely monitored, with an estimated potential 5% impact on operating costs [71] - The company is optimistic about the future, with expectations for increased production and lower costs in the coming years [32][46] Other Important Information - The company repurchased 1.5 million shares during the second quarter, with a total of 2.9 million shares repurchased in the first half of the year [14] - Freeport-McMoRan has a solid balance sheet with investment-grade ratings and no significant debt maturities until 2027 [53] Q&A Session Summary Question: Changes in mine plan and modeling updates - Management updates quarterly forecasts and has recalibrated the Grasberg ore grade model due to observed differentials in recovery rates [60][61] Question: Impact of tariffs on cost outlook - Tariffs are being monitored closely, with a potential 5% impact on costs, but the company is focused on driving efficiencies and cost reductions [71][73] Question: Discussions with the U.S. administration regarding financing or incentives - The company has engaged with U.S. government representatives to discuss its role as a major copper producer and potential incentives for domestic production [80][81] Question: Potential tariff exemptions for refined copper - No known exemptions for refined copper are currently anticipated, and the company is awaiting further details on tariff implementation [84] Question: Internal cost to operate the new smelter in Indonesia - The operating cost of the new smelter is estimated at approximately $0.27 per pound, with additional revenues expected from processing [88] Question: Thoughts on building a smelter in the U.S. - The company is studying the potential for expanding the Miami smelter but emphasizes the near-term opportunity lies in the leach initiative [95][98]
